4 Fig. 3 Comparison of GI index values at four lung volume levels at 25%, 50%, 75% and 100% of maximum inspiratory volume. CF: the GI values of 14 patients in the CF group; H: the GI of 14 healthy volunteers in the control group. The red lines indicate the median. The boxes mark the quartiles while the whiskers show the most extreme data values within 1.5 times the interquartile range of the sample. **P<0.01, 20% greater than the GI values of CF100.
